CAVIA
Cerebral amyloid angioathy: vascular imaging and fluid biomarkers of amyloid deposition

To identify novel biomarkers for Cerebral Amyloid Angiopathy, including body fluid (cerebrospinal fluid, blood) and imaging (MRI) biomarkers.
